  • Using PDF files for items rather than .png.

    Hi there
    We have been looking into improving iBook production. We have a few books that feature elements that are comprise of a background image with text over the top. As the text isn't in an iPad-friendly font (I.e. not in iOS) and it doesn't have to be searchable. Previously, the items have been produced individually either in Illustrator or Photoshop. The main 'problem' with this is the plethora of file it creates, and the huge amount to time taken to apply style changes across all the separate items, save, re-import into iBA, and re-apply all the iBA-specific attributes.
    In an effort to speed up production somewhat, we have been trying to create these items in InDesign, using style sheets etc to give standardised appearance across all the items, and then drag and drop into iBA. The advantage is that all the separate items are in one document, and all style changes can be instantly applied to all items instantaneously, saving time, space, and effort.
    It places them as PDFs, and after unzipping the .iba file, the PDFs look fine, with pin-sharp text (as you'd expect, as PDF text would be vector data. Similarly, when you zoom in to the items in iBA, the text is still pin-sharp.
    However, once the iBA is previewed on a iPad, the text goes a little blurry. As one of the fonts is a dot-matrix-type font, the effect is noticeable - all the dots blur together into a line.
    Does anyone have any idea as to what is happening to the PDF between iBA and the iPad? Does it rasterise it at some point?

    Hi Ken
    'What leads me think it would?', well the fact that it worked, and looks ok. The iBook previews fine and works fine on the iPad.
    We initially came up with the idea when we 'unzipped' an .iba file (you know, changing the .iba extension to .zip, then unarchiving the contents), and found that iBA itself had created .pdf files for the full-screen photos which appeared rotated and shadowed on the iPad page, but were viewed as straight, unshadowed, images. (the rotated version was the iBA-created PDF file, the full-screen was the original .jpg we pulled into iBA). Naturally, we were surprised. So we started mucking about, and found that drag/drop from ID worked, and looked OK.
    As an update to my original post, it appears that the difference in quality was due to the fonts used. Once we opened the .PDFs within the .iba file, we converted the text to outlines, resaved the .pdfs, changed the unzipped folder back to an .iba file, and the font now looks great.

  • Can I use a pdf file as a website and can it be protected?

    If I create a pdf file (that will eventually end up around 600 A4 pages)
    how can I use that file alone as a website, please?
    Is it also possible to do a pdf file for my website that does not allow the visitor
    to save, print or in any way store a copy of my pdf file, please?
    Any help here is appreciated as I know only just a little about pdf files.
    Many thanks for reaidng me.
    Kevin

    The PDF can be linked on a web site, but it is not HTML and will not display as a web site. It would ALWAYS  be downloaded and opened in a PDF viewer -- Acrobat, Reader, GView, etc. You can not restrict the saving of the PDF. Once it has been opened on a client machine, it has been saved locally. Thus a user would only have to copy the file from the download location -- though many users do not know how to do this. If you want the PDF to be secure in some sense so that it can not be used if copied and such, then you have to use Digital Rights at a substantial cost (in the $1000s).

  • How do I add a PDF file for download to my iWeb page?

    How do I add a PDF file for download to my iWeb page?
    I have created one using Apples Pages program.
    Thanks!

    Hi-
    You need to create a text link to the file...
    On your page, type a word that you want to be the link... then select the word, and in the inspector pane, click the link tab (the arrow on the far right) and check "enable as hyperlink." Then choose "file" from the dropdown menu and a chooser box will open for you to locate the file on your hard drive.
    Choose the file by clicking "open" once it's located. Then the next time you publish, the file will be uploaded and linked to!
    Hope this helps... I think I got all the steps in there!

  • How can I reduce the size of a pdf file for emailing?

    I want to send a pdf file which is 8 mb, it has bounced in an email because it is too big, how can I reduce the size of the pdf file for emailing?

    Sometimes a simple "Save As" will reduce the file size slightly, but probably not enough to pass the <8 mb threshold of your recipient, as you need.
    You've probably seen it, try the next option in the Save As menu, "Reduced Size PDF," and make it compatible with the latest version possible, again considering the recipient. This suggestion assumes Acrobat X. You don't say which version you're using, but this tool was available at least going back to Version 8, but in a different place, you'll have to hunt.
    If all that doesn't work, you could remove some images from the source document, which also will reduce the overall size.
    Best luck.
